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_002201.6(ISG20):ā€‹c.222G>Cā€‹(p.Arg74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000118 in 1,613,812 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(ā˜…).

ISG20 (HGNC:6130): (interferon stimulated exonuclease gene 20) Enables 3'-5' exonuclease activity and RNA binding activity. Involved in defense response to virus; negative regulation of viral genome replication; and nucleobase-containing compound catabolic process. Located in cytoplasm and nuclear lumen.
